It isn’t fake, and it’s not an easter egg. It’s from the very last interactive sequence in the game when you face the Marquise who is armed with a knife. This sequence is timed and if you don’t throw the book in the fireplace fast enough or simply not do anything at all just to see what happens like I did, then she stabs you in the eye and kills you as depicted above.

It’s so unbelievably obvious what to do at that point in the game that I imagine most people simply do the right thing and never see the death sequence, which is a shame because there is another of those great stick figure animations after you die.
